WebThe Family Relationships Index was based on the three subscales that compose the relationship domain of the Family Environment Scale. These subscales are cohesion, expressiveness, and conflict. Scoring on conflict was reversed so that all subscales would be scores in the same direction (Holahan & Moos, 1983 ). Webcohesion in developing a "family systems" model for clinical application. They identify two components of family cohesion: "the emotional bonding members have with one …

WebJan 22, 2024 · Family cohesion refers to the degree of family closeness and caring among family members. A close-knit family has strong family bonds that include emotional closeness and support.
